    How to turn OFF trackpad on MacBook Air when using Magic Trackpad?

    Hi, I have a question about the trackpad on my mac. The question is whether there is a utility that lets us disable it temporarily. For example, when I write or when I play with Windows to use the magic trackpad or with the mouse that came with my laptop. The model I have is the latest generation MacBook Air. I had seen in the settings but cannot find any solution for the same. I am quiet sure there can be some way to make this work.

    Re: How to turn OFF trackpad on MacBook Air when using Magic Trackpad?

    If you use a laptop, you can tell the computer to ignore the trackpad when typing or when you connect a mouse.

    To inactivate the trackpad:


    Choose Apple menu> System Preferences, click Keyboard & Mouse and then click Trackpad.

    Open the panel Trackpad preference pane Keyboard & Mouse

    Set trackpad options:

    Ignore accidental trackpad: it makes the computer ignore the trackpad when typing.

    Ignore trackpad when mouse is connected: it makes the computer ignore the trackpad when mouse is connected.

    Re: How to turn OFF trackpad on MacBook Air when using Magic Trackpad?

    To allow full use gestures on the trackpad Multi-Touch, even when a mouse is connected, the trackpad option "Ignore trackpad when mouse is connected" no longer appears in System Preferences on Mac OS X 10.5.6, Mac OS X 10.5.7 and Mac OS X 10.5.8. On the MacBook, MacBook Pro and MacBook Air trackpad with Multi-Touch Mac OS X 10.6 Snow Leopard, the option used to enable or disable the "Ignore trackpad when mouse is connected" is in the Mouse tab and trackpad on the Universal Access pane of System Preferences.
